Ligne 4 : |
Ligne 4 : |
| | | |
| Si vous désirez obtenir le code complet directement, cliquez [[ici]] | | Si vous désirez obtenir le code complet directement, cliquez [[ici]] |
− |
| |
− | {{ambox | text = Avant de commencer à programmer, vérifiez que vous avez bien tout connecté avec l'Arduino !}}
| |
− |
| |
− | == Pré-configuration de l'environnement ==
| |
− |
| |
− | Dans ce tutoriel, nous travaillons sur l'environnement d'ArduinoIDE. Si vous ne l'avez pas encore installé, vous pouvez le télécharger [https://www.arduino.cc/en/Main/Software ici].
| |
− |
| |
− |
| |
− | Premièrement, il vous faudra :
| |
− |
| |
− | * Créer un nouveau projet : Fichier -> Nouveau
| |
− | * Installer la bibliothèque '''RTClib''' de chez '''Adafruit''' ([[Installation_d'un_librairie_Arduino|comment installer ?]])
| |
− | * Ajouter les [https://github.com/adafruit/Adafruit_LED_Backpack fichiers] '''Adafruit_LEDBackpack.h''' et '''Adafruit_LEDBackpack.cpp''' dans le dossier où se trouve votre code.
| |
− |
| |
− |
| |
− | Si vous considéré que vous avez correctement effectuer la pré-configuration, nous allons effectuer un test pour vérifier si le RTC (''Reel Time Clock'') et l'afficheur 4x7 segments sont correctements configurés.
| |
− |
| |
− | Copiez le code dans fichier ino (ouvert préalablement sur ArduinoIDE)
| |
− | <syntaxhighlight lang="c">
| |
− | #include "Adafruit_LEDBackpack.h"
| |
− | #include <RTClib.h>
| |
− | </syntaxhighlight>
| |
− |
| |
− | {{ambox | text = Si une erreur de bibliothèque s'affiche, veuillez vérifier si tout à été correctement effectué}}
| |
− |
| |
− |
| |
− | == Code complet ==
| |
− | <syntaxhighlight lang="c">
| |
− | </syntaxhighlight>
| |
− |
| |
− |
| |
− | {{traduction}}
| |
− |
| |
− | * Comment Téléverser le programme
| |
− | * Description des parties importantes du programme (des constantes aussi)
| |
− |
| |
− | {{Mon-Reveil-TRAILER}}
| |